Hawkins v Allen
Image source, PA MediaFour of the eight quarter-finalists are left-handers - and two of them meet in the other quarter-final that will get under way shortly.
Northern Ireland's Mark Allen has previously won the Masters and the UK Championship - the other two titles in snooker's Triple Crown - but is yet to reach a final at the World Championship.
His quarter-final opponent, Englishman Barry Hawkins, has reached finals at all three Triple Crown events but a first title has so far eluded him. He was beaten in the 2013 Crucible final by Ronnie O'Sullivan.
